Job description

About the Role

Effective School Solutions is currently seeking a Mental Health Technician to join our team in Nashua, NH. The Mental Health Technician is responsible for direct client care including in-classroom social-emotional counseling, crisis management and de-escalation, and data collection and observation. The Mental Health Technician assists with classroom management and structuring when required. The starting salary for this position is $55,000. Job Responsibilities Promote and deliver trauma-attuned interventions consistent with needs of the student in a safe and ethical manner that promote and sustain academic and mental health stability. Assist students with activities of daily school day; attends to student behavioral needs and provide assistance in de-escalation and crisis intervention, as needed. Work with other members of the ESS/classroom multi-disciplinary team in leading/assisting student activities and groups. Understand and follow classroom management protocols and daily schedules. Understand continuum of mental health services within the school environment and greater community supports. Perform miscellaneous job-related duties as assigned. Develop strong working relationships with school/District leadership, teachers and paraprofessionals. Maintain confidentiality of student records and strong professional boundaries. Participate in all ESS team training and meetings. Document student observations, following prescribed procedures and standards.

Qualifications

Bachelor’s degree in social work, psychology, or related field. Licensed Behavioral Therapist, preferred. Two or more years of experience working in a mental health setting, preferably with children and adolescents ages 5-18. Experience and knowledge of mental illness treatment with highly acute children and adolescents and continuum of care (crisis management experience strongly preferred).
